Motion capture (sometimes referred as mo-cap or mocap , for short) is the process of recording the movement of objects or people. It is used in military , entertainment , sports , medical applications, and for validation of computer vision and robotics. In filmmaking and video game development , it refers to recording actions of human actors , and using that information to animate digital character models in 2D or 3D computer animation . When it includes face and fingers or captures subtle expressions, it is often referred to as performance capture . In many fields, motion capture is sometimes called motion tracking , but in filmmaking and games, motion tracking usually refers more to match moving .
